netdev_printk/netif_printk: Remove a superfluous logging colon

netdev_printk originally called dev_printk with %pV.

This style emitted the complete dev_printk header with
a colon followed by the netdev_name prefix followed
by a colon.

Now that netdev_printk does not call dev_printk, the
extra colon is superfluous.  Remove it.

Example:
old: sky2 0000:02:00.0: eth0: Link is up at 100 Mbps, full duplex, flow control both
new: sky2 0000:02:00.0 eth0: Link is up at 100 Mbps, full duplex, flow control both
